Transaction ccd91e405183b8961e412488f52c01fe5688c763e5c69b8747c9168666058223

1 Input
2 Outputs
  • ccd91e405183b8961e412488f52c01fe5688c763e5c69b8747c9168666058223:0
  • value  310000
    address  3KaH66CCWjJ8F98ANbzh8qpJS6cNusiqzk
  • ccd91e405183b8961e412488f52c01fe5688c763e5c69b8747c9168666058223:1
  • value  25701750
    address  1HGUoF81kMKNHHTRDaZzcR6Ga4KAZVeRNT